Compact Construction Equipment Market Overview

Source: Secondary Research, Interviews with Experts, MarketsandMarkets Analysis

The global compact construction equipment market is projected to grow from USD 39.62 billion in 2025 to USD 56.21 billion by 2032 at a CAGR of 5.1%. The compact construction equipment market is experiencing steady growth as construction operators increasingly prefer cost-efficient and versatile machinery for urban redevelopment and small-scale infrastructure projects. Also, compared to full-sized equipment, the lower leasing and transportation costs of these compact machines make them particularly appealing to rental operators and small to mid-sized contractors.

Driver: Rapid urbanization to fuel the demand for compact construction equipment in the residential and commercial sectors

Rapid urbanization, particularly in developing countries, drives strong demand for compact construction equipment that can operate efficiently in tight urban spaces. With the UN projecting that 68% of the global population will live in cities by 2050, the need for infrastructure, residential, and commercial projects is surging. Compact machinery such as mini excavators, compact track loaders, skid steer loaders, and compactors is increasingly deployed to meet this demand. Asia is a key growth region, with India enabling 100% FDI in township development and launching the PM Awas Yojana Urban 2.0 (USD 120.16 Bn) to support housing for 10 million urban families, Japan seeing real estate investments of USD 10.2 Bn in 2023 (up 12.3% YoY), and China implementing pilot schemes to boost private real estate investments. These factors underscore strong future growth prospects for the compact construction equipment market.

Restraint: Stringent regulations and geopolitical issues

Strict international trade regulations and geopolitical tensions restrain the growth of the compact construction equipment market. Governments are increasingly introducing rules and standards that complicate global trade; for instance, the European Commission’s revised Construction Products Regulation (Regulation 3110/2024), effective January 2025 with full enforcement by January 2026, aims to enhance sustainability, digitalization, and standardization in the construction sector, impacting equipment trade in Europe. Additionally, geopolitical issues, such as ongoing US–China trade tensions and tariffs on Chinese construction equipment imports, increase costs, create trade uncertainties, discourage investments, and constrain opportunities for manufacturers reliant on global supply chains.

Opportunity: Advancements in hydrogen-propelled compact construction equipment

Advancements in hydrogen ICE-powered compact construction equipment present a significant growth opportunity for market players as the industry shifts toward sustainable practices. Leading OEMs like JCB have introduced hydrogen combustion engines in models such as the 3DX backhoe loader, while other manufacturers are pursuing collaborations and developments to strengthen their market position. Global initiatives, including India’s National Hydrogen Mission, the US National Clean Hydrogen Strategy, the EU Hydrogen Strategy, China Hydrogen Alliance, and Japan’s Hydrogen Basic Strategy, are driving the adoption of hydrogen as an alternative fuel. Hydrogen-powered equipment addresses practical challenges in remote construction sites lacking electric charging infrastructure and supports global sustainability goals, positioning the market for significant growth in the coming years.

Challenge: Battery-related issues in electric compact construction equipment

Electric compact construction equipment faces significant challenges due to battery limitations, including inadequate capacity, frequent recharging, and long charging times, which restrict operational hours and increase machine downtime. These issues disrupt project timelines and have reinforced the preference for diesel-powered machinery, which offers more reliable performance. Additionally, limited space in compact equipment constrains the use of larger batteries needed to extend operational time, forcing manufacturers to balance battery size with performance. These constraints present ongoing challenges in achieving optimal functionality and efficiency for electric compact construction equipment.

Compact Construction Equipment Market, By Engine Capacity

Compact construction equipment with an engine capacity of above 3.5 L is used in backhoe loaders, mini excavators, and telehandlers. These equipment types are best-suited for heavy applications like material hoisting and large-scale excavation projects, as they have better payload, excavation, and material handling capacities. Caterpillar (US), Case (Italy), and Komatsu (Japan) offer compact construction equipment featuring these engines. North America is projected to account for the largest share in this market segment due to the rise in construction expenditure and growing urbanization.

Compact Construction Equipment Market, By Equipment Type

Asia Pacific is projected to be the fastest-growing segment for backhoe loaders during the forecast period. The segment's progress can be attributed to increased public and private investments driving the growth of the construction industry. Initiatives, such as the “Smart City” programs in India, are anticipated to further boost construction activities in Tier II cities. These construction activities are expected to impact the sales of backhoe loaders significantly.

Compact Construction Equipment Market, By Function

Asia Pacific is projected to dominate the excavation segment due to ongoing investments in the construction industry. In 2024, Japan invested ~USD 48 billion in building construction, and Indonesia spent USD 649 million on infrastructure development through the “Indonesia Infrastructure and Finance Compact.” These investments have created a demand for mini excavators in the Asia Pacific.

Compact Construction Equipment Market, By Power Output

61 – 100 HP is the dominant segment in the compact construction equipment market by power output. These category engines are primarily equipped in equipment such as Mini excavators, Compact track loaders, Telehandlers, and Backhoe loaders, which contribute to ~50% of the global compact equipment market. Correspondingly, North America and the Asia Pacific have substantial sales for this category of equipment. Asia Pacific has a high demand for excavators, whereas North America leads the global market for compact track loaders. Additionally, these categories of equipment strike a right balance between operational output and efficiency, which further propels the growth of the segment.

Compact Construction Equipment Market, By Propulsion Type

Diesel dominates the compact equipment ICE segment, accounting for nearly 99% of the market, due to high power output, strong torque, and long engine life. Well-developed diesel infrastructure ensures fast refueling and easy availability. Users are cautious about CNG/ LNG/RNG because of limited infrastructure and uncertain performance. Currently, the Asia Pacific has the highest demand for diesel-propelled equipment due to the presence of emerging economies such as India and Indonesia. However, CNG, LNG, and RNG have notable demand in Latin America due to incentives and lower fuel costs.

Electric & Hydrogen Compact Construction Equipment Market, By Equipment Type

Electric-propelled equipment is gaining traction in Europe and North America. The European region currently has the highest adoption of electric-propelled equipment, particularly for electric mini excavators. Major players such as Kubota Corporation (Japan) and Volvo Construction Equipment (Sweden) have launched a range of electric mini excavators focusing on the European market. These players offer mini excavators ranging from 20HP to 80-100 HP models, serving a wide range of customers. Hydrogen-propelled compact equipment is also expected to enter commercial markets in the coming 2-3 years. JCB (UK) has already launched a backhoe loader powered by a 74HP hydrogen ICE.   Additionally, JCB has also secured full EU type-approval for its hydrogen combustion engine for use in off-highway equipment under Regulation (EU) 2016/1628, certifying it to EU Stage V emissions norms. Unlike electric propulsion, hydrogen engines offer zero tailpipe CO2 emissions while delivering diesel-like performance without the challenges of battery weight, charging downtime, or rare-material dependence.

Electric Construction Equipment Market, By Battery Chemistry

Many OEMs are transitioning to use LFP batteries over lithium nickel manganese cobalt (NMC). The market for LFP batteries is estimated to be the largest in the Asia Pacific compared to Europe and North America due to their cost-effectiveness compared to NMC, long-cycle life, and high thermal stability.

REGION

During the forecast period, North America is expected to be the largest region in the global compact construction equipment market.

North America remains the largest market for compact construction equipment, driven by strong residential development, infrastructure upgrades, and the widespread use of compact track loaders, telehandlers, mini excavators, and compactors for versatile job site applications. Compact track loaders dominate the regional market due to their suitability for landscaping, roadwork, and utility projects. Meanwhile, telehandlers are the fastest-growing equipment type, supported by increasing use in material handling, logistics yards, and urban redevelopment. Both local OEMs like Caterpillar, Deere & Company, and Bobcat, and foreign players such as Volvo CE and Kubota are expanding production and introducing high-performance, low-emission models to strengthen their market presence. Electrification is gaining traction, with electric mini excavators leading adoption amid growing sustainability goals and stricter emission regulations. To meet surging demand, Doosan Bobcat is investing USD 300 million in a new compact loader manufacturing facility in Mexico, slated to open in 2026, aimed at reinforcing its dominance in the North American compact equipment market.

Market Size Estimation

As mentioned below, a detailed market estimation approach was followed to estimate and validate the value of the compact construction equipment market and other dependent submarkets.

The bottom-up approach was used to estimate and validate the compact construction equipment market size. The compact construction equipment market size, by equipment and country, was derived by mapping the historical sales of different equipment at the country level. These data points were largely fetched from the country-level associations, off-highway databases, and OEM data excerpts. The market size, by value, was derived by multiplying the equipment-wise average selling price with the respective equipment volume calculated in units. Each country/region's total volume and value of each country/ region are then summed up to reveal the total volume of the global compact construction equipment market for each type. The data was validated through primary interviews with industry experts. The compact construction equipment market is further segmented into power output, engine capacity, propulsion, and electric equipment. The penetration of different segments was derived from secondary research and primary interviews.

The gathered market data was consolidated, enhanced with detailed inputs, analyzed, and presented in this report.

Market Definition

Compact Construction equipment is machinery that performs specific construction or demolition functions. These equipment are portable/semi-permanent and are primarily used for excavation, loading, lifting and, hoisting and compaction applications. It is also used in other applications such as infrastructure, residential, commercial, and industrial buildings.

The equipment considered in the study have been selected based on power output, all under 120 HP.
